This vast city, six times the size of present-day Sian, was laid out in nine months on a grid plan, with eastern and western markets and the Imperial City placed in the central northern section, a plan later followed at Peking.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11463954-111141358745459660?l=badkettle.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/feeds/111141358745459660/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11463954&amp;postID=111141358745459660'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111141358745459660'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111141358745459660'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/2005/02/arts-east-asian-architecture.html' title='Arts, East Asian, Architecture'/><author><name>BadKettle</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/02967220783867975546</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11463954.post-111309092618750843</id><published>2005-02-11T21:55: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-04-09T16:55:26.186-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Catalan Literature</title><content type='html'>Largest trade-union federation in India. INTUC was established in 1947 in cooperation with the Indian National Congress, which favoured a less militant union movement than the All-India Trade Union Congress. INTUC is largely anticommunist; it is affiliated with the International Confederation of Free Trade Unions.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11463954-111309092618750843?l=badkettle.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/feeds/111309092618750843/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11463954&amp;postID=111309092618750843'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111309092618750843'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111309092618750843'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/2005/02/catalan-literature_11.html' title='&lt;a href=&apos;http://thickdoor.blogspot.com&apos; title=&apos;Door Blog&apos;&gt;Catalan Literature&lt;/a&gt;'/><author><name>BadKettle</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/02967220783867975546</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11463954.post-111141358969750752</id><published>2005-02-10T21:05: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-21T05:59:49.696-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Salghurid Dynasty</title><content type='html'>The Salghurids were one of the several dynasties of atabegs (notables who acted as guardians and tutors of infant Seljuq princes) who were deputized to govern Iranian provinces on behalf of Seljuq kings. Founded near the end of the 19th century, La Romana grew rapidly after the establishment of a large sugar mill in 1911. In addition to sugarcane, the surrounding region produces coffee, tobacco, beeswax, cattle, and hides. The city has food-processing and soap, shoe, and furniture plants.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11463954-111309092889812902?l=badkettle.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/feeds/111309092889812902/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11463954&amp;postID=111309092889812902'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111309092889812902'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111309092889812902'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/2005/02/la-romana.html' title='&lt;a href=&apos;http://fatlibrary.blogspot.com&apos; title=&apos;Fatlibrary&apos;&gt;La Romana&lt;/a&gt;'/><author><name>BadKettle</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/02967220783867975546</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11463954.post-111141359379177793</id><published>2005-01-31T11:36: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-21T05:59:53.793-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Sabae</title><content type='html'>City, Fukui ken (prefecture), Honshu, Japan, in the northern end of the Takefu basin. A striking example is the radiation, beginning in the Tertiary period (beginning 66.4 million years ago), of basal mammalian stock into forms adapted to running, leaping, climbing, swimming, and flying.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11463954-111309093381012979?l=badkettle.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/feeds/111309093381012979/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11463954&amp;postID=111309093381012979'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111309093381012979'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111309093381012979'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/2005/01/adaptive-radiation.html' title='&lt;a href=&apos;http://seriouscurtain.blogspot.com&apos; title=&apos;The Serious Curtain&apos;&gt;Adaptive Radiation&lt;/a&gt;'/><author><name>BadKettle</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/02967220783867975546</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11463954.post-111141360242028718</id><published>2005-01-08T23:23: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-21T06:00:02.420-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Argentina</title><content type='html'>Carlos Menem's 10-year tenure as Argentine president ended on Dec. 10, 1999. Auburn, Antarctic Law and Politics (1982), provides a comprehensive discussion of the legal aspects of the Antarctic Treaty, jurisdictional problems of crime, ecology, and tourism. Gillian D. Triggs (ed.), The Antarctic Treaty Regime: Law, Environment, and Resources (1987), discusses current aspects of issues raised by the Antarctic Treaty. Anthony Parsons, Antarctica: The Next Decade (1987), addresses the history of the Antarctic Treaty and its future as well as current and projected uses of the continental region.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11463954-111141363864831992?l=badkettle.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/feeds/111141363864831992/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11463954&amp;postID=111141363864831992'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111141363864831992'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11463954/posts/default/111141363864831992'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://badkettle.blogspot.com/2004/11/antarctica-general-works.html' title='Antarctica, General works'/><author><name>BadKettle</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/02967220783867975546</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11463954.post-111309094592410121</id><published>2004-11-24T09:32: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-04-09T16:55:45.926-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Paarl</title><content type='html'>Town, Western Cape province, South Africa, east of Cape Town, on the Groot-Berg River between the Paarl Mountain and the Drakenstein Range.
